Structural properties of screened Coulomb balls

Abstract
Small three-dimensional strongly coupled charged particles in a spherical confinement potential arrange themselves in a nested shell structure. By means of experiments, computer simulations and theoretical analysis, it is shown that their structural properties depend on the type of interparticle forces. Using an isotropic Yukawa interaction, quantitative agreement for shell radii and occupation is obtained.
